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of medical instruments, and discloses a feeding device for cardiovascular medicine, which comprises a shell, and the outer side of the shell is fixedly connected with a feeding pipe; the flow condition of liquid food is monitored, when the flow of the liquid food is within a specified range, feeding operation is automatically started, when the flow is smaller than a specification range, flow blocking operation is started, automatic early warning is carried out, medical workers are prompted to process, the structures are closely connected, the automation degree is high, automatic intermittent pressure feeding is facilitated, choking and coughing caused by overfeeding are be effectively avoided, manual operation is avoided, labor is effectively saved, and operation is convenient, which is more in line with the actual use needs. Pipe bodies at the two ends of a filter chamber are automatically blocked from the filter chamber, flowing of the liquid food is hindered, the situation that the liquid food continuously flows to the filter chamber and the blockage of the filter chamber is aggravated is avoided, and meanwhile the situation that when the blockage problem is solved, flushing fluid flows to a conveying pipe is solved, and convenience is provided for blockage treatment operation.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of medical devices, in particular to a feeding device for cardiovascular medicine. Background technique [0002] Most patients with cardiovascular diseases usually need to be hospitalized due to surgery or extreme discomfort during treatment. Long-term bed rest will degrade body functions, and they cannot eat normal food. They need to eat liquid food to supplement nutrition. [0003] Generally, medical staff push and feed with the aid of syringes, which is cumbersome to operate, time-consuming and laborious, and increases the labor intensity of medical staff. At the same time, during the feeding process, there are larger particles in the liquid food. If it is eaten directly, it is not conducive to the patient's recovery, and the patient's food safety cannot be guaranteed, so it needs to be filtered.
